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Cursor moving towards bottom right corner when repeatedly triggering warpd #2993

Open
glyh opened this issue Aug 16, 2023 · 5 comments
Open
Labels
bug Something isn't working

Comments

@glyh
Copy link

glyh commented Aug 16, 2023

Hyprland Version

Hyprland, built from branch main at commit 4986d74 dirty (xwayland: fix use of xwayland coords in native spaces). Tag: v0.28.0-58-g4986d74e flags: (if any)

Bug or Regression?

Bug

Description

As title. When repeatedly triggering warpd, my cursor moves towards the bottom right corner.

How to reproduce

  1. Install wayland, hyprland-git and warpd-git on arch linux
  2. start hyprland and repeatedly trigger warpd

Crash reports, logs, images, videos

c.mp4
@glyh
Copy link
Author

glyh commented Aug 16, 2023

Also opened as rvaiya/warpd#265

@UserSv4
Copy link
Contributor

UserSv4 commented Nov 6, 2023

I have the same problem, did some investigating and it seems to actually be a workaround made specifically to make warpd work with Hyprland and it's caused by https://github.com/rvaiya/warpd/blob/01650eabf70846deed057a77ada3c0bbb6d97d6e/src/platform/linux/wayland/screen.c#L97

@glyh
Copy link
Author

glyh commented Nov 6, 2023

@UserSv4 probably we should also open an issue there?

@UserSv4
Copy link
Contributor

UserSv4 commented Nov 6, 2023

@UserSv4 probably we should also open an issue there?

Like a second one (you've already opened rvaiya/warpd#265)?

@glyh
Copy link
Author

glyh commented Nov 6, 2023

Okay I'll reference to your comment there.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
bug Something isn't working
Projects
None yet
Development

No branches or pull requests

2 participants